Question

Dans mon application, je valide les e-mails; Mais nous pouvons donner plus d'une adresse e-mail séparée avec un point-virgule (";"). Comment puis-je écrire l'expression de validation?

Mes e-mails ressemblent à ceci:

"sasidhar@yahoo.com;suryasasidhar@gmail.com;srinivas@gmail.com "

Comment puis-je écrire une expression régulière pour cela?

Était-ce utile?

La solution

Vous pouvez essayer ceci:

\w+([-+.]\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*([,;]\s*\w+([-+.]\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*)*

C'est de la part de Regexlib.com

Autres conseils

Commencez par le Email de base regex puis postuler comme suit:

<email regex>(;<email regex>)*
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top